
Uzodimma Imo West Senate bid — The Governor of Imo State, Hope Uzodimma, has officially declared his intention to contest for the Imo West Senatorial ticket under the platform of the All Progressives Congress (APC).
Uzodimma announced his decision through a statement shared on his verified Facebook account on Sunday, thereby ending weeks of political speculation surrounding his next political move ahead of the forthcoming elections.
In the statement, the governor expressed appreciation to party stakeholders and supporters across Imo West, popularly known as Orlu Zone, for their continued confidence in his leadership.

“After wide consultations with leaders, stakeholders, and the good people of Imo West, I have accepted the call to serve our people at the National Assembly,” Uzodimma reportedly stated.
Meanwhile, the declaration has further intensified the political contest within the APC in Imo West Senatorial District as other influential politicians have also shown strong interest in the seat.
Former Imo State Governor, Rochas Okorocha, alongside the incumbent senator representing the zone, Senator Osita Izunaso, are also seeking the APC ticket for the senatorial position.
Political observers believe the contest may become one of the most closely watched intra-party battles in the state due to the calibre of aspirants involved.
Furthermore, APC leaders from Imo West had, about two weeks ago, publicly declared Uzodimma as their consensus candidate. The party leaders also confirmed the purchase of the APC nomination form for the governor, insisting that he remains their preferred choice for the seat.
“Governor Uzodimma has demonstrated quality leadership and deserves our total support for the Senate,” one of the party leaders reportedly said during the earlier endorsement gathering.
However, supporters of other aspirants have continued mobilization efforts across the zone, insisting that the contest should remain open and competitive.
As political activities continue to gather momentum in Imo State, analysts expect intense consultations, negotiations, and strategic alignments among APC stakeholders before the party’s primary election.
The development has already generated mixed reactions among party faithful and political observers, with many closely monitoring how the APC leadership will manage the growing competition among top political figures within the party.
